Journey through a kaleidoscope of images, patterns and synergies into the otherworldly language of light
From the extraordinary Bangarra Dance Theatre comes an iridescent new theatrical experience. Drawing together music, visual arts and dance, Illume explores the awe of light, a bridge between the physical and spiritual worlds.
Created in collaboration by Mirning choreographer Frances Rings and Goolarrgon Bard visual artist Darrell Sibosado, Illume explores the ways light has captivated and sustained Indigenous cultural existence for millennia. Illume asks the urgent question: is the deep wisdom passed down from elders enough to illuminate a path forward from the shadows of a dark future?
